Transaction 3272bec7433177f1ae5142807af31bcae34246ed6a07c505f354b564066bb765

1 Input
2 Outputs
  • 3272bec7433177f1ae5142807af31bcae34246ed6a07c505f354b564066bb765:0
  • value  1362724
    address  1CWcWfiAKtyKCKfWSwreJLCMbWUK6yYtBB
  • 3272bec7433177f1ae5142807af31bcae34246ed6a07c505f354b564066bb765:1
  • value  24975370
    address  bc1q84k44jfm3wyxa3wd4wdh9p3l3lmpunm088hfwqtrv4jcmdmh6vtq2nenn0